Fedora 44 with Gnome 50 on a Framework 12 laptop.
I figured out the problem though. I had the "disable touchpad while typing" setting toggled, and of course, it registers the holding-down of spacebar as "typing" and dutifully disables the touchpad. If I untoggle that setting, it works.
Might be worth finding a way around it. I imagine that's a popular setting to have activated.
